Transaction e00861530678010aceff4bfecdd7a03952aa625e6833cdb0d0f96ce08de888da
1 Input
1 Output
-
e00861530678010aceff4bfecdd7a03952aa625e6833cdb0d0f96ce08de888da:0
- value
- 89884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f2b33611ccfc2968228dabf5098e736a5e80b64 OP_EQUAL
- address
- 3BppgUTZGq2H7dWGscYCRg2GTk86eAZpaH